#56a58d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56a58d is composed of 33.7% red, 64.7%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.5%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 161.8 degrees, a saturation of 31.5% and a lightness of 49.2%. #56a58d color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#004b1b.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#56a58d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a09 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#56a58d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7e7e is the less saturated color, while #09f2ab is the most saturated one.
